* Safran is an international high-technology group, operating in the aviation (propulsion, equipment and interiors), defense and space markets. Its core purpose is to contribute to a safer, more sustainable world, where air transport is more environmentally friendly, comfortable and accessible. Safran has a global presence, with 100,000 employees and sales of 27.3 billion euros in 2024, and holds, alone or in partnership, world or regional leadership positions in its core markets.
Safran is in the 2nd place in the aerospace and defense industry in TIME magazine's "World's best companies 2024" ranking.
Safran Cabin designs, certifies, manufactures and supports innovative aircraft cabin interiors, equipment and systems, providing airlines and OEM Customers with distinctive aircraft branding, and their passengers with a safe, comfortable and enjoyable flying experience.

** Job description*
* Job Summary:
The Stockroom Supervisor supervises a team of stockroom clerks to ensure effective utilization of resources to support the business operation. This job reports to the Logistics Manager.
Summary of Duties:
1. Supervise stockroom clerks, plan work assignments, schedule daily activities and overtime needs.
2. Develop time standards for each job function and clearly communicate expectations to employees.
3. Train stockroom clerks on Safran Logistics and Stockroom Standards as well as MRP transactions.
4. Execute cycle counts in an organized manner. Maintain inventory cycle count program and reports metrics as required.
5. Analyze cycle count results to identify problem areas and implement improvements.
6. Monitor supply usage patterns and place purchase requisitions.
7. Interface with Planning and Production to establish and improve material delivery practices.
8. Understand and complete transactions in ERP system to maintain inventory accuracy.
9. Ensure all safety requirements are met for mobile equipment, inventory area and raw material storage area.
10. Perform all other duties as assigned.
